Promoting social-emotional learning (SEL) effectively involves integrating activities that foster self-regulation and enhance interpersonal skills. These activities allow students to understand and manage their emotions, develop empathy for others, establish positive relationships, and make responsible decisions.

Implementing strategies that focus on self-regulation helps students learn to control their impulses, manage stress, and stay motivated, which are crucial for both academic success and personal well-being. Interpersonal skills activities, such as group work, role-playing, and discussions, encourage collaboration and communication, enabling students to navigate social environments more effectively.

By combining these methods, teachers create a nurturing environment that supports emotional growth alongside academic achievement, ensuring that students are well-rounded and prepared for real-life interactions. This holistic approach is essential for fostering a safe and supportive learning atmosphere where all students can thrive academically and socially.
